Key ideas in Hindi: Beyond the Basics
- The subject 'I' must take the postposition 'ko' to become 'mujhko' or 'mujhe'
- Lagna describes how a stimulus or situation strikes a person personally
- The object (tea) becomes the thing that 'is pleasing' rather than the thing being acted upon
- The person experiencing the feeling must be marked with 'ko/mujhe'
- The structural shift from 'I like' to 'To me, it is pleasing'
- Using 'lagna' to describe personal impressions
- The person (with 'ko') comes first in the sentence
- Activities act like nouns in 'liking' sentences
- The infinitive verb form (e.g., bolna, khana) is used as the subject of the liking
- The 'pasand hai' phrase concludes the sentence
- Sentences using 'pasand' (liking) require the 'ko' structure
- Sentences using 'lagna' (it seems/feels) require the 'ko' structure
- Correct word order for an opinion sentence
- Identifying when to use the 'ko' structure for preferences
- The verb 'chaahna' is used to express wanting or desiring
- The main action verb takes the oblique infinitive form ending in -naa
